2016-01-19 17 views
6

sto Transizione di progetto da Babele a dattiloscritto e visualizzato il seguente errore del compilatore:I risultati di destrutturazione dell'oggetto dattiloscritto sono "Assegnazione proprietà prevista".

error TS1136: Property assignment expected. 

dal codice che assomiglia a questo:

var auth = {...this.props.auth}; 

Questo codice precedentemente lavorato bene in Babel, ma fa sì che il errore sopra quando si tenta di compilare tramite Typescript. La destrutturazione di oggetti è differente in Typescript?

+2

non dovrebbe essere 'var {auth} = this.props;'? – Icepickle

+1

Non è questa sintassi ES7? – MinusFour

risposta

Problemi correlati